On September 3, 2026, OpenAI announced Daybreak for Frontline Defenders, a $1 billion commitment intended to put frontier cybersecurity models, training, and technical help into organizations that protect essential services. The headline is large, but the structure matters: this is subsidized access and support targeted for consumption over six months, not a $1 billion cash fund.
The first priorities are water and wastewater operators, electric-grid organizations, state and local governments, community and regional banks, nonprofits, and open-source maintainers. Those are precisely the teams likely to run aging systems with limited security staff, which makes the program consequential if access turns into validated fixes rather than a larger queue of unreviewed vulnerability reports.
What the OpenAI Daybreak commitment actually provides
OpenAI describes four forms of support inside the $1 billion commitment: subsidized access to Daybreak models and products, training, technical assistance, and partnerships. It does not publish an allocation across those categories, so there is no verified dollar value for model credits versus staff support.
Daybreak itself has two access paths. Daybreak Blue uses OpenAI's mainline models for common defensive work. Daybreak Red gives approved organizations access to specialized cyber models for more sensitive tasks. OpenAI says thousands of defenders across 2,000 approved organizations and workspaces already use the program.
The new initiative adds a pilot with the Multi-State Information Sharing and Analysis Center, or MS-ISAC, for state, local, tribal, and territorial defenders. It also expands the Daybreak Defense Network, where more than 35 partner products and partner-operated services are bringing the models into security tools and workflows customers already use.

The important shift is from finding flaws to fixing them
AI systems can generate vulnerability findings faster than many teams can validate them. That can create a defensive bottleneck rather than remove one. OpenAI's stronger claim is therefore operational: Daybreak can help review legacy code and configurations, validate findings, prioritize risk, develop patches, test them, and confirm fixes.
That sequence is the right mechanism to evaluate. A model-generated report has limited value until a qualified person confirms the issue, assesses the blast radius, tests a repair, and deploys it safely. OpenAI's related Defense Factory architecture makes the same point by placing human review and existing engineering controls around agent-driven discovery and patch preparation.

Why critical infrastructure is a harder environment
Water, energy, and local-government systems are not ordinary software estates. Maintenance windows are constrained, equipment can stay in service for decades, and an incorrect automated action can interrupt a physical service. Those conditions make bounded permissions, audit trails, change review, and rollback procedures as important as raw model capability.
The program also sits beside a real tension in OpenAI's 2026 releases. GPT-6 Astra crossed the company's Critical cyber-capability threshold, leading OpenAI to restrict its strongest offensive functions. Daybreak is the distribution strategy on the defensive side: widen access for verified defenders while keeping more dangerous capabilities gated. What evidence should come next
The announcement establishes scale, intended users, and a delivery channel. It does not yet establish outcomes. The useful follow-up metrics would be validated vulnerabilities, median time from finding to deployed fix, false-positive rates, incidents avoided, and the share of subsidized access used by small public operators rather than large partners.
OpenAI says the initial $1 billion is targeted for use over six months and that it plans to expand to partner countries in the coming weeks. That makes the next reporting window unusually short. The program should be judged on whether resource-constrained defenders ship safer systems, not on the face value of model access allocated.
